The Master of Aboriginal Health is a postgraduate degree focused on improving Aboriginal health and health care through advanced study and research-informed practice. You’ll build biomedical and public health knowledge while examining culturally safe approaches, health systems, and community priorities. The course is designed to support impact in Aboriginal health settings through specialist postgraduate training in health sciences. The programme develops advanced clinical reasoning, health leadership, and evidence-based practice for complex care environments.

Graduates may work in Aboriginal health services, public health programs, government and non-government agencies, and community-led organisations. Typical pathways include Aboriginal health program coordinator, policy or research officer, health service project roles, and roles supporting culturally safe care and evaluation. This postgraduate qualification supports leadership and specialist careers across Aboriginal and Indigenous health within the health sciences sector. Preparing graduates for clinical leadership, health management, and advanced nursing or allied health specialist roles.
